Anambra: Akai Egwuonwu formally declares to contest Senatorial by-election

Share this:

Industrialist and businessman, Chief Akai Egwuonwu, on Sunday, formally declared interest in the upcoming Anambra South senatorial by-election, on the platform of the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A).

The declaration which took place at his country home in Amichi, Nnewi South local government area, attracted APGA leaders and stakeholders from the seven local government areas of Anambra South.

In his declaration speech, Chief Akai Egwuonwu asked for the support of APGA in all the seven LGAs of Anambra South, with a strong appeal that it is fair for Nnewi South, from the same Nnewi political bloc, to go.

While speaking on his legislative agenda, Chief Egwuonwu said that he has only three key areas he would channel his energy and ingenuity when elected to the senate.

The first is security. Anambra South has a peculiar security challenge, and he pledged to deal with this challenge at once, leveraging late Sen. Ubah’s milestones.

Secondly, Chief Akai also assured of a special attention towards boasting small and medium businesses with grants.

Narrating his experience with small business owners in parts of Anambra South and how the UK Government supports small businesses, Chief Egwuonwu said that helping medium and small scale businesses with funding options is a priority for him when elected as Anambra South senator.

Thirdly, he also pledged to use all legislative instruments such as motions, bills, and oversight to foster the interests of his constituents.

Those in attendance include, Chief Maja Umeh, BOT member of APGA, Barr Egwuoyibo Okoye, Hon. Barr. Kingsley Iruba, Hon. Van George Ezeogidi, Azubuike Osuchukwu, among many other stakeholders from Nnewi South, all of whom made a case to other six LGAs to support Nnewi South and Chief Akai Egwuonwu’s aspiration.
